    Quote Originally Posted by Kaos View Post
    What are you doing as far as edge burnishing?
    I either use one of my burnishing tools, a bone folder, or a sharpie. water, then dye (if dyeing) then gum tragacanth. all after beveling with a beveling tool.

    Gum trag and a bone folder are how I burnish the interior.

    Get one of these get a 1/4" bolt about an inch and a half long, lock the wheel on the bolt with a nut. Chuck it in a drill. Nice burnished edges, easy.

    I use edge kote, wait for it to dry, then burnish. But that's just me, everyone has their own way!

    I use some gum tragacanth on the edges and rub the boning tool as fast as I can back and forth. The more heat you create, the nicer it comes out (just don't burn it). Of course, if you want to take the easy way out, use the burnishing wheel.
